UNITED FAMILIES & FRIENDS CAMPAIGN (UFFC) PROCESSION ON SATURDAY 26TH OCTOBER 2013
The United Families and Friends Campaign (UFFC) is a coalition of families and friends of those that have died in the custody of police and prison officers as well as those who are killed in immigration detention and secure psychiatric hospitals.

1) a mother whose 24 year old son was gunned down while sitting in the back of a car (judicial inquiry that was stymied for 8 years found no lawful justification for the shooting)

2) The aunt of an unarmed 29 year old who was shot by multiple officers and whose entire family has suffered character assassination in the wake of his murder,

3) A young man and a middle aged woman both beaten brutally by the police for attending peaceful protests (the young man almost died, and the woman is still in a wheel chair recovering from a badly broken leg, kicked viciously by a police officer at an anti-fascist protest this past summer),

NOT ONE POLICE OFFICER HAS BEEN BROUGHT TO ACCOUNT SINCE 1969

4) The case of Talha Ahsan, recounted by his brother, Hamja Ahsan. Talha was imprisoned six years with no charge in the UK, then extradited over a year ago to the U.S. where he is currently languishing in a Supermax facility in Connecticut, though he is a British citizen who has never been to the United States, and has never been implicated in any act of violence. On the contrary, Talha is a gifted scholar and poet who uses words to challenge injustice. Talha has still not had a trial, and any trial should be held in his home country.
